Sajod village is located in the Sardarpur Tehsil of the Dhar district in Madhya Pradesh .
Block / Tehsil → Sardarpur
District → Dhar
State → Madhya Pradesh
Sajod village has a total population of 1,727 people, of which 878 are males and 849 are females.
The literacy rate of Sajod village is 61.32%. Male literacy stands at 77.90% and female literacy at 44.17%.
There are approximately 381 households in Sajod village.
Sardarpur (38 km) is the nearest town to Sajod village for major economic activities and is located approximately 38 km away.
The population of Sajod village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 684 | 375 | 1,059 |
| Illiterate | 194 | 474 | 668 |
| Total | 878 | 849 | 1,727 |
Source: Census 2011
